Trinity Seven 43

Woah! That sure was surprising, seriously. I knew Trinity Seven is pretty good and is entertaining almost all of the time, but in this genre, harem action, you almost never see this... but it happened.
Arata+Liese lose in round one of the tournament to Arin+Yui. Yes, the male lead loses in the first match to two of his haremites! How often does THAT happen in this genre? It's got to be incredibly uncommon, the genre is usually about how the MC guy always wins everything against girls because well he's male and they aren't etc. Arata is strong, but the girls in this series are too; he might be the strongest overall, but as this showed, it's not a sure thing, and that's great. Also on that note he is a magic king candidate, of course, but so are some girls. This is very much a harem series, but the girls are more capable compared to the protagonist than many, thankfully! This might be one of the better things about this series. How fun the tone is one of the best things for sure (this probably should be such a bleak and depressing series...), but that's high on the list.

Now, I wouldn't be at all surprised if he saves the day by the end of this arc, but still, good and surprising chapter. I liked it!
